Verse (4:142), Word 5 - Quranic Grammar

__

The fifth word of verse (4:142) is divided into 2 morphological segments. A circumstantial particle and personal pronoun. The connective particle wa is usually translated as "while" and is used to indicate the circumstance of events. The personal pronoun is third person masculine singular.

Chapter (4) sūrat l-nisāa (The Women)


(4:142:5)
wahuwa
and (it is) He
CIRC – prefixed circumstantial particle
PRON – 3rd person masculine singular personal pronoun
الواو حالية
ضمير منفصل

Verse (4:142)

The analysis above refers to the 142nd verse of chapter 4 (sūrat l-nisāa):

Sahih International: Indeed, the hypocrites [think to] deceive Allah , but He is deceiving them. And when they stand for prayer, they stand lazily, showing [themselves to] the people and not remembering Allah except a little,
